The new Bentley Continental GT is on sale, and it’s a little while yet before we see a new drop-top GTC or Flying Spur limo, so at the VW Group’s 2011 Geneva motor party Bentley revealed a limited-run Supersports Convertible. Just 100 Bentley Supersports ‘Ice Speed Record’ Convertibles will ever be made. There is, but this is the Ice Speed Record Supersports Convertible, built to celebrate Bentley's recent, err, ice speed record; just a few weeks ago, on the frozen Baltic Sea just off the coast of Finland, four-time world rally champ Juha Kankkunen drove a Supersports Convertible to 205mph.

Chrysler eight-speed gearbox to boost big sedans' fuel economy

Thu, 01 Sep 2011

Chrysler Group says its new eight-speed automatic transmission will be the first offered on domestically produced automobiles and will boost fuel economy and cut emissions of the company's two full-sized, rear-drive sedans. The transmission initially will be available on 2012 Chrysler 300s and Dodge Chargers powered by Chrysler's 292-hp Pentastar V6 engine, the automaker said Thursday in a statement. The cars are being assembled and will start arriving in dealerships by Oct.
